Chinese scientists have proposed to explore Mars using hypersonic drones

By 2035, China promises to create a hypersonic aircraft that can transport anywhere on Earth in one hour,

and in another 10–15 years, China will have a fleet of such spacecraft that will deliver people to low-Earth orbit. Now Beijing scientists will use hypersonic technology to explore Mars.

Mars' highly tenuous atmosphere complicatesthe use of conventional planes and helicopters the atmosphere of the Red Planet. To solve the problem, Chinese scientists have proposed the use of hypersonic drones - compact aircraft for flights across Mars.

According to the calculations of Professor Xu Xu and his colleaguesfrom the School of Astronautics at Beihang University in Beijing, a 500kg fueled drone can fly over Martian terrain at five times the speed of sound for 1,000 km.

“The first hypersonic flight on Mars is not expectedearlier than 30 years later. There are a lot of technical issues to be resolved, ”Xu explains. "But when humans begin to colonize Mars, there will be a need for transport that will fly long distances."

The atmosphere of Mars is 96% carbon dioxidegas, which means that normal oxidation processes in liquefied fuel are impossible. There will be no combustion, as in the Earth's atmosphere. But some metals, for example, magnesium, burn well in carbon dioxide. 

For the efficiency of the magnesium engine, Chinesescientists propose using two sequential combustion chambers. This will solve the problem of low thrust of such engines. At the beginning of the exploration of Mars, magnesium can be imported from Earth, and then used by local developments. According to researchers, there is some magnesium ore on the Red Planet.
